Workland presents a unique career opportunity within the Conseil scolaire catholique Nouvelon, a French-language school board recognized for the excellence of its educational program. CSC Nouvelon welcomes over 5,400 students distributed across 35 teaching locations, including 25 elementary schools, 9 secondary schools, and the Carrefour Options+, and has approximately 1,600 employees.
Located in the heart of a dynamic territory with a large Francophone population, covering Chapleau, Dubreuilville, Espanola, Greater Sudbury, Hornepayne, Michipicoten, North Shore, Sault Ste-Marie, and Sudbury-East, CSC Nouvelon holds a prime position among French-language school boards in Ontario and French Canada. JOB SUMMARY
Reporting to the Director of Education and Secretary-Treasurer, the Superintendent of Education contributes to the implementation of the CSC Nouvelon's multi-year strategic plan. Working in an environment of professional collaboration, this educational leader ensures the success and well-being of every student in a Francophone and Catholic environment.
The incumbent is also responsible for school supervision as well as systemic files, including the Mathematics Success Action Plan, in accordance with the Education Act and its regulations. They contribute to the implementation of the Council's vision for the future of learning, promote French-language Catholic education, and adhere to Francophone culture and Catholic values.
YOUR M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ES
Supervise student success, teaching, and curriculum implementation in the schools under their responsibility
Participate in the development and revision of the Council's improvement plan and set SMART objectives aligned with the strategic plan
Measure and manage the effectiveness of school principals through student results, and build their leadership capacity
Establish a shared vision focused on language, faith, and culture, and translate it into concrete objectives with school teams
Build trusting relationships with students, staff, families, and community partners
Direct the teaching program by ensuring that student results remain at the center of decisions and resource allocation
Administer the files and budgets entrusted to them, including the piloting of the Mathematics Success Action Plan
Act as a resource person for the School Board, the Catholic Education Council and their committees, and present reports to them
Recruit, mentor, and retain staff mobilized around the Council's objectives
Represent the Council in its relations with the Ministry, community agencies, and various external organizations
RE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E
Minimum of ten (10) years of experience with increasing responsibility in educational leadership positions
Master's or doctorate level education
Member in good standing and certificate of qualification from the Ontario College of Teachers
